Three firms have held, simultaneously, the name Supercomputer Systems or Supercomputing Systems. The first was founded by Steve Chen, architect of the Cray X-MP and Cray Y-MP. The second was based in San Diego, CA, USA. The third still exists in Zurich, Switzerland.
SSI(1): Supercomputer Systems, Inc., Eau Claire, WI, S. Chen
SSI(2): Supercomputer Systems, Inc., San Diego, CA
SSI(3): Supercomputing Systems, AG, Zurich, CH
